[QUOTE="Dougiebaby, post: 926791, member: 125234"] Hi Kenny, Unfortunately, I do not know what specs 3-D CAD requires, so I can not make a recomendation between the PC vs. Mac. However, if you are considering the two Macs, I believe the MacBook Pro 13 is far superior to the MacBook. Not only do you get the aluminum housing, 7 hour battery and faster processor, but... DDR3 RAM (MacBook Pro) vs. DDR2 RAM (in the MacBook) backlit keyboard a trackpad that utilizes multi-touch gesters To me, these features are definitely worth the extra $250. [/QUOTE]
